public class SolrSearchQueryTemplateModel extends ItemModel
AbstractItemModel.NewModelContextFactory| Modifier and Type | Field and Description |
|---|---|
static String |
_SOLRINDEXEDTYPE2SOLRSEARCHQUERYTEMPLATE
Generated relation code constant for relation
SolrIndexedType2SolrSearchQueryTemplate defining source attribute indexedType in extension solrfacetsearch. |
static String |
_TYPECODE
Generated model type code constant.
|
static String |
FTSQUERYBUILDER
Generated constant - Attribute key of
SolrSearchQueryTemplate.ftsQueryBuilder attribute defined at extension solrfacetsearch. |
static String |
FTSQUERYBUILDERPARAMETERS
Generated constant - Attribute key of
SolrSearchQueryTemplate.ftsQueryBuilderParameters attribute defined at extension solrfacetsearch. |
static String |
GROUP
Generated constant - Attribute key of
SolrSearchQueryTemplate.group attribute defined at extension solrfacetsearch. |
static String |
GROUPFACETS
Generated constant - Attribute key of
SolrSearchQueryTemplate.groupFacets attribute defined at extension solrfacetsearch. |
static String |
GROUPLIMIT
Generated constant - Attribute key of
SolrSearchQueryTemplate.groupLimit attribute defined at extension solrfacetsearch. |
static String |
GROUPPROPERTY
Generated constant - Attribute key of
SolrSearchQueryTemplate.groupProperty attribute defined at extension solrfacetsearch. |
static String |
INDEXEDTYPE
Generated constant - Attribute key of
SolrSearchQueryTemplate.indexedType attribute defined at extension solrfacetsearch. |
static String |
INDEXEDTYPEPOS
Generated constant - Attribute key of
SolrSearchQueryTemplate.indexedTypePOS attribute defined at extension solrfacetsearch. |
static String |
NAME
Generated constant - Attribute key of
SolrSearchQueryTemplate.name attribute defined at extension solrfacetsearch. |
static String |
PAGESIZE
Generated constant - Attribute key of
SolrSearchQueryTemplate.pageSize attribute defined at extension solrfacetsearch. |
static String |
RESTRICTFIELDSINRESPONSE
Generated constant - Attribute key of
SolrSearchQueryTemplate.restrictFieldsInResponse attribute defined at extension solrfacetsearch. |
static String |
SEARCHQUERYPROPERTIES
Generated constant - Attribute key of
SolrSearchQueryTemplate.searchQueryProperties attribute defined at extension solrfacetsearch. |
static String |
SEARCHQUERYSORTS
Generated constant - Attribute key of
SolrSearchQueryTemplate.searchQuerySorts attribute defined at extension solrfacetsearch. |
static String |
SHOWFACETS
Generated constant - Attribute key of
SolrSearchQueryTemplate.showFacets attribute defined at extension solrfacetsearch. |
_COMMENTITEMRELATION, COMMENTS, CREATIONTIME, ITEMTYPE, MODIFIEDTIME, OWNER, PKLANGUAGE_FALLBACK_ENABLED_SERVICE_LAYER, MODEL_CONTEXT_FACTORY| Constructor and Description |
|---|
SolrSearchQueryTemplateModel()
Generated constructor - Default constructor for generic creation.
|
SolrSearchQueryTemplateModel(ItemModelContext ctx)
Generated constructor - Default constructor for creation with existing context
|
SolrSearchQueryTemplateModel(SolrIndexedTypeModel _indexedType,
String _name)
Deprecated.
Since 4.1.1 Please use the default constructor without parameters
|
SolrSearchQueryTemplateModel(SolrIndexedTypeModel _indexedType,
String _name,
ItemModel _owner)
Deprecated.
Since 4.1.1 Please use the default constructor without parameters
|
| Modifier and Type | Method and Description |
|---|---|
String |
getFtsQueryBuilder()
Generated method - Getter of the
SolrSearchQueryTemplate.ftsQueryBuilder attribute defined at extension solrfacetsearch. |
Map<String,String> |
getFtsQueryBuilderParameters()
Generated method - Getter of the
SolrSearchQueryTemplate.ftsQueryBuilderParameters attribute defined at extension solrfacetsearch. |
Integer |
getGroupLimit()
Generated method - Getter of the
SolrSearchQueryTemplate.groupLimit attribute defined at extension solrfacetsearch. |
SolrIndexedPropertyModel |
getGroupProperty()
Generated method - Getter of the
SolrSearchQueryTemplate.groupProperty attribute defined at extension solrfacetsearch. |
SolrIndexedTypeModel |
getIndexedType()
Generated method - Getter of the
SolrSearchQueryTemplate.indexedType attribute defined at extension solrfacetsearch. |
String |
getName()
Generated method - Getter of the
SolrSearchQueryTemplate.name attribute defined at extension solrfacetsearch. |
Integer |
getPageSize()
Generated method - Getter of the
SolrSearchQueryTemplate.pageSize attribute defined at extension solrfacetsearch. |
Collection<SolrSearchQueryPropertyModel> |
getSearchQueryProperties()
Generated method - Getter of the
SolrSearchQueryTemplate.searchQueryProperties attribute defined at extension solrfacetsearch. |
Collection<SolrSearchQuerySortModel> |
getSearchQuerySorts()
Generated method - Getter of the
SolrSearchQueryTemplate.searchQuerySorts attribute defined at extension solrfacetsearch. |
boolean |
isGroup()
Generated method - Getter of the
SolrSearchQueryTemplate.group attribute defined at extension solrfacetsearch. |
boolean |
isGroupFacets()
Generated method - Getter of the
SolrSearchQueryTemplate.groupFacets attribute defined at extension solrfacetsearch. |
boolean |
isRestrictFieldsInResponse()
Generated method - Getter of the
SolrSearchQueryTemplate.restrictFieldsInResponse attribute defined at extension solrfacetsearch. |
boolean |
isShowFacets()
Generated method - Getter of the
SolrSearchQueryTemplate.showFacets attribute defined at extension solrfacetsearch. |
void |
setFtsQueryBuilder(String value)
Generated method - Setter of
SolrSearchQueryTemplate.ftsQueryBuilder attribute defined at extension solrfacetsearch. |
void |
setFtsQueryBuilderParameters(Map<String,String> value)
Generated method - Setter of
SolrSearchQueryTemplate.ftsQueryBuilderParameters attribute defined at extension solrfacetsearch. |
void |
setGroup(boolean value)
Generated method - Setter of
SolrSearchQueryTemplate.group attribute defined at extension solrfacetsearch. |
void |
setGroupFacets(boolean value)
Generated method - Setter of
SolrSearchQueryTemplate.groupFacets attribute defined at extension solrfacetsearch. |
void |
setGroupLimit(Integer value)
Generated method - Setter of
SolrSearchQueryTemplate.groupLimit attribute defined at extension solrfacetsearch. |
void |
setGroupProperty(SolrIndexedPropertyModel value)
Generated method - Setter of
SolrSearchQueryTemplate.groupProperty attribute defined at extension solrfacetsearch. |
void |
setIndexedType(SolrIndexedTypeModel value)
Generated method - Initial setter of
SolrSearchQueryTemplate.indexedType attribute defined at extension solrfacetsearch. |
void |
setName(String value)
Generated method - Setter of
SolrSearchQueryTemplate.name attribute defined at extension solrfacetsearch. |
void |
setPageSize(Integer value)
Generated method - Setter of
SolrSearchQueryTemplate.pageSize attribute defined at extension solrfacetsearch. |
void |
setRestrictFieldsInResponse(boolean value)
Generated method - Setter of
SolrSearchQueryTemplate.restrictFieldsInResponse attribute defined at extension solrfacetsearch. |
void |
setSearchQueryProperties(Collection<SolrSearchQueryPropertyModel> value)
Generated method - Setter of
SolrSearchQueryTemplate.searchQueryProperties attribute defined at extension solrfacetsearch. |
void |
setSearchQuerySorts(Collection<SolrSearchQuerySortModel> value)
Generated method - Setter of
SolrSearchQueryTemplate.searchQuerySorts attribute defined at extension solrfacetsearch. |
void |
setShowFacets(boolean value)
Generated method - Setter of
SolrSearchQueryTemplate.showFacets attribute defined at extension solrfacetsearch. |
getComments, getCreationtime, getModifiedtime, getOwner, setComments, setCreationtime, setModifiedtime, setOwnerequals, getItemModelContext, getItemtype, getPersistenceContext, getPk, getProperty, getProperty, getTenantId, hashCode, readResolve, setProperty, setProperty, toObject, toObject, toObject, toObject, toObject, toObject, toObject, toObject, toPrimitive, toPrimitive, toPrimitive, toPrimitive, toPrimitive, toPrimitive, toPrimitive, toPrimitive, toString, writeReplacepublic static final String _TYPECODE
public static final String _SOLRINDEXEDTYPE2SOLRSEARCHQUERYTEMPLATE
SolrIndexedType2SolrSearchQueryTemplate defining source attribute indexedType in extension solrfacetsearch.public static final String NAME
SolrSearchQueryTemplate.name attribute defined at extension solrfacetsearch.public static final String SHOWFACETS
SolrSearchQueryTemplate.showFacets attribute defined at extension solrfacetsearch.public static final String RESTRICTFIELDSINRESPONSE
SolrSearchQueryTemplate.restrictFieldsInResponse attribute defined at extension solrfacetsearch.public static final String GROUP
SolrSearchQueryTemplate.group attribute defined at extension solrfacetsearch.public static final String GROUPPROPERTY
SolrSearchQueryTemplate.groupProperty attribute defined at extension solrfacetsearch.public static final String GROUPLIMIT
SolrSearchQueryTemplate.groupLimit attribute defined at extension solrfacetsearch.public static final String GROUPFACETS
SolrSearchQueryTemplate.groupFacets attribute defined at extension solrfacetsearch.public static final String PAGESIZE
SolrSearchQueryTemplate.pageSize attribute defined at extension solrfacetsearch.public static final String FTSQUERYBUILDER
SolrSearchQueryTemplate.ftsQueryBuilder attribute defined at extension solrfacetsearch.public static final String FTSQUERYBUILDERPARAMETERS
SolrSearchQueryTemplate.ftsQueryBuilderParameters attribute defined at extension solrfacetsearch.public static final String INDEXEDTYPEPOS
SolrSearchQueryTemplate.indexedTypePOS attribute defined at extension solrfacetsearch.public static final String INDEXEDTYPE
SolrSearchQueryTemplate.indexedType attribute defined at extension solrfacetsearch.public static final String SEARCHQUERYPROPERTIES
SolrSearchQueryTemplate.searchQueryProperties attribute defined at extension solrfacetsearch.public static final String SEARCHQUERYSORTS
SolrSearchQueryTemplate.searchQuerySorts attribute defined at extension solrfacetsearch.public SolrSearchQueryTemplateModel()
public SolrSearchQueryTemplateModel(ItemModelContext ctx)
ctx - the model context to be injected, must not be null@Deprecated public SolrSearchQueryTemplateModel(SolrIndexedTypeModel _indexedType, String _name)
_indexedType - initial attribute declared by type SolrSearchQueryTemplate at extension solrfacetsearch_name - initial attribute declared by type SolrSearchQueryTemplate at extension solrfacetsearch@Deprecated public SolrSearchQueryTemplateModel(SolrIndexedTypeModel _indexedType, String _name, ItemModel _owner)
_indexedType - initial attribute declared by type SolrSearchQueryTemplate at extension solrfacetsearch_name - initial attribute declared by type SolrSearchQueryTemplate at extension solrfacetsearch_owner - initial attribute declared by type Item at extension core@Accessor(qualifier="ftsQueryBuilder", type=GETTER) public String getFtsQueryBuilder()
SolrSearchQueryTemplate.ftsQueryBuilder attribute defined at extension solrfacetsearch.@Accessor(qualifier="ftsQueryBuilderParameters", type=GETTER) public Map<String,String> getFtsQueryBuilderParameters()
SolrSearchQueryTemplate.ftsQueryBuilderParameters attribute defined at extension solrfacetsearch.@Accessor(qualifier="groupLimit", type=GETTER) public Integer getGroupLimit()
SolrSearchQueryTemplate.groupLimit attribute defined at extension solrfacetsearch.@Accessor(qualifier="groupProperty", type=GETTER) public SolrIndexedPropertyModel getGroupProperty()
SolrSearchQueryTemplate.groupProperty attribute defined at extension solrfacetsearch.@Accessor(qualifier="indexedType", type=GETTER) public SolrIndexedTypeModel getIndexedType()
SolrSearchQueryTemplate.indexedType attribute defined at extension solrfacetsearch.@Accessor(qualifier="name", type=GETTER) public String getName()
SolrSearchQueryTemplate.name attribute defined at extension solrfacetsearch.@Accessor(qualifier="pageSize", type=GETTER) public Integer getPageSize()
SolrSearchQueryTemplate.pageSize attribute defined at extension solrfacetsearch.@Accessor(qualifier="searchQueryProperties", type=GETTER) public Collection<SolrSearchQueryPropertyModel> getSearchQueryProperties()
SolrSearchQueryTemplate.searchQueryProperties attribute defined at extension solrfacetsearch.
Consider using FlexibleSearchService::searchRelation for pagination support of large result sets.@Accessor(qualifier="searchQuerySorts", type=GETTER) public Collection<SolrSearchQuerySortModel> getSearchQuerySorts()
SolrSearchQueryTemplate.searchQuerySorts attribute defined at extension solrfacetsearch.
Consider using FlexibleSearchService::searchRelation for pagination support of large result sets.@Accessor(qualifier="group", type=GETTER) public boolean isGroup()
SolrSearchQueryTemplate.group attribute defined at extension solrfacetsearch.@Accessor(qualifier="groupFacets", type=GETTER) public boolean isGroupFacets()
SolrSearchQueryTemplate.groupFacets attribute defined at extension solrfacetsearch.@Accessor(qualifier="restrictFieldsInResponse", type=GETTER) public boolean isRestrictFieldsInResponse()
SolrSearchQueryTemplate.restrictFieldsInResponse attribute defined at extension solrfacetsearch.@Accessor(qualifier="showFacets", type=GETTER) public boolean isShowFacets()
SolrSearchQueryTemplate.showFacets attribute defined at extension solrfacetsearch.@Accessor(qualifier="ftsQueryBuilder", type=SETTER) public void setFtsQueryBuilder(String value)
SolrSearchQueryTemplate.ftsQueryBuilder attribute defined at extension solrfacetsearch.value - the ftsQueryBuilder@Accessor(qualifier="ftsQueryBuilderParameters", type=SETTER) public void setFtsQueryBuilderParameters(Map<String,String> value)
SolrSearchQueryTemplate.ftsQueryBuilderParameters attribute defined at extension solrfacetsearch.value - the ftsQueryBuilderParameters@Accessor(qualifier="group", type=SETTER) public void setGroup(boolean value)
SolrSearchQueryTemplate.group attribute defined at extension solrfacetsearch.value - the group@Accessor(qualifier="groupFacets", type=SETTER) public void setGroupFacets(boolean value)
SolrSearchQueryTemplate.groupFacets attribute defined at extension solrfacetsearch.value - the groupFacets@Accessor(qualifier="groupLimit", type=SETTER) public void setGroupLimit(Integer value)
SolrSearchQueryTemplate.groupLimit attribute defined at extension solrfacetsearch.value - the groupLimit@Accessor(qualifier="groupProperty", type=SETTER) public void setGroupProperty(SolrIndexedPropertyModel value)
SolrSearchQueryTemplate.groupProperty attribute defined at extension solrfacetsearch.value - the groupProperty@Accessor(qualifier="indexedType", type=SETTER) public void setIndexedType(SolrIndexedTypeModel value)
SolrSearchQueryTemplate.indexedType attribute defined at extension solrfacetsearch. Can only be used at creation of model - before first save.value - the indexedType@Accessor(qualifier="name", type=SETTER) public void setName(String value)
SolrSearchQueryTemplate.name attribute defined at extension solrfacetsearch.value - the name@Accessor(qualifier="pageSize", type=SETTER) public void setPageSize(Integer value)
SolrSearchQueryTemplate.pageSize attribute defined at extension solrfacetsearch.value - the pageSize@Accessor(qualifier="restrictFieldsInResponse", type=SETTER) public void setRestrictFieldsInResponse(boolean value)
SolrSearchQueryTemplate.restrictFieldsInResponse attribute defined at extension solrfacetsearch.value - the restrictFieldsInResponse@Accessor(qualifier="searchQueryProperties", type=SETTER) public void setSearchQueryProperties(Collection<SolrSearchQueryPropertyModel> value)
SolrSearchQueryTemplate.searchQueryProperties attribute defined at extension solrfacetsearch.value - the searchQueryProperties@Accessor(qualifier="searchQuerySorts", type=SETTER) public void setSearchQuerySorts(Collection<SolrSearchQuerySortModel> value)
SolrSearchQueryTemplate.searchQuerySorts attribute defined at extension solrfacetsearch.value - the searchQuerySortsCopyright © 2017 SAP SE. All Rights Reserved.